As we all know, Gemstone Jewelry is wonderful but easily damaged. When wearing jewelry, there is much need for you to try to protect any jewelry from scratches, sharp blows, harsh chemicals, extreme temperatures and sunlight.
A little time and effort on your part will keep your gemstone looking new from the day you purchase it. By having your gemstone set in a relatively protective setting, and remaining conscious of it on your finger, you can keep your gemstone intact for a lifetime.
Here are some tips for you to follow simply but to benefit your gems greatly.
- Put your jewelry on after washing and applying any makeup or hair spray which do a lot of harm to jewelry.
- After removing your gemstone jewelry, wipe it with a soft cloth to remove dirt and other residues.
- Be certain to remove your gemstone rings when doing household tasks such as gardening and cleaning etc.
- Take off jewelry before swimming in a swimming pool since the chlorine can cause damage to various gemstones and gold. Gemstones may become loose in their settings and even fall out.
- Before doing high impact sports, be sure to take off your jewelry as you may scratch the metal or chip the gemstones.
- Store jewelry separately in a lined case or a soft cloth, so the gems do not touch each other or parts of other jewelry so as not to scratch each other or be damaged externally.
- Always avoid storing your jewelry next to a heating vent, window sill or on a car dashboard.
- Store jewelry away from sunlight as the sun may fade the gemstones.
- Always store bead necklaces (such as lapis, pearls, etc) flat as silk stretches over time.
Besides, periodically inspect your gemstone and setting for weakness or damage and take it to a professional jeweler for immediate repair if you notice any deterioration. It is a good idea to have your gemstone cleaned by a professional and have the security of the setting checked once a year.
